About this event

Wander through the verdant heritage gardens of Singapore Botanic Gardens, a UNESCO-listed Heritage Garden. Discover the origins of plant research in the region, and learn how education and conservation blossomed from its leafy paths.

Date: Sunday, 07 September 2025

Time: 8:30am – 10:30am

Meet: Tanglin Gate (nearest MRT: Napier Station)

End: National Orchid Garden

Organized by

Society of Tourist Guides (Singapore) was started in 2003 by a group of trainer guides with guiding experience between 18 to 30 years.The Society held its first International Tourist Guide Day (ITGD) event on 21 February 2004, with member guides offering free walking tours in Chinatown, Emerald Hill, Singapore River, Fort Canning and many more.

ITGD has been celebrated ever since at various site including Esplanade Park, Sentosa, Singapore Botanic Gardens, National Museum of Singapore, National Gallery Singapore, Asian Civilisation Museum etc. 

The Society works closely with Singapore Tourism Board and other industry partners to promote the professionalism of tourist guides as the Tourism Ambassadors of Singapore.
